I applied online. The process took 4 weeks. I interviewed at CodeCombat
Interview
The process was quite lengthy. It involved a take-home assignment that took 4 hours to complete. A tech screening was thrown into the process where the interviewee is expected to write a program on-the-spot. It seemed a bit over the top for a curriculum development position. There's a strong company focus on knowing code syntax rather than learning theory and overall computer science concepts.
